







The Pinball nut, known in industry circles as the steel ball nut or elastic nut, is a highly specialized fastener that features an innovative steel ball structure. This unique design is pivotal in a variety of mechanical connection and assembly scenarios, providing unparalleled reliability and versatility.
• Structural construction: The architecture of the Pinball nut is ingeniously crafted, comprising a nut body, steel ball, and reset spring. The nut body, typically block-shaped, boasts a central threaded hole, primed for secure bolt passage. Ingeniously designed holes on the bottom or side accommodate the steel ball, creating a harmonious fit. The reset spring within these holes provides the necessary elastic support. Exemplifying this thoughtful design, some marble nuts feature two centrally symmetrical steel ball holes, allowing the steel balls to slightly protrude from the nut's surface, thanks to the reset spring's action.
Working principle: The marvel of the Pinball nut lies in its ability to fasten and position through the dynamic interplay of friction and elasticity. When integrated into grooves, such as those found in aluminum profiles, the reset spring ensures that the steel ball exerts firm pressure against the groove's inner wall. This intimate contact generates substantial friction, effectively impeding any sliding motion and guaranteeing steadfast positioning. Moreover, during bolt connections, the steel balls assist in auto-locating the nut's position, even in challenging installation environments, facilitating rapid alignment with bolts and drastically improving installation efficiency.
Material selection: The choice of materials for the Pinball nut is paramount. Nut bodies are crafted from robust materials like stainless steel, known for its exceptional rust and corrosion resistance, making it ideal for wet and corrosive environments such as those in food processing or chemical machinery. Alternatively, carbon steel is favored for its cost-effectiveness and high strength, prevalent in general mechanical manufacturing and construction. For the steel balls, high-hardness metals like bearing steel are selected to ensure superior wear resistance and compressive strength, guaranteeing reliable performance over prolonged usage.
Product advantages: Simplifying installation, the Pinball nut can often be manually pressed into aluminum grooves without complex tools or advanced skills, making it accessible for various users. It boasts a stellar positioning effect, maintaining steadfast stability across vertical, inclined, or any installation surface. Additionally, it offers remarkable seismic performance, ensuring the connection's integrity and minimizing loosening risks under vibrating conditions.
Application scenario: The Pinball nut is indispensable in constructing industrial aluminum profile frames, seamlessly connecting profiles to assemble mechanical protective fences, automation equipment racks, and assembly line workbenches. It's a staple in electronic device manufacturing, precisely fixing internal components and meeting precision assembly needs. Furthermore, in scenarios like display stands or experimental devices where rapid assembly and disassembly are critical, the Pinball nut's unique advantages make it a preferred choice, offering unparalleled convenience and precision.
